Save for later

Closures in Swift

Heads up! This course may be archived and/or unavailable.

Intermediate iOS,

One of the more powerful features in Swift are closures. Closures allow you to encapsulate functionality and context and pass it around in your code. In this course, we’re going to take a look at the underlying principles behind closures, write some useful functions that take closures and understand the nuances of closures as reference types

What you'll learn
  • Higher Order Functions
  • Closure syntax
  • Closure expression syntax
  • Inline closures
  • Memory management
Segments in this Workshop
    Get Details and Enroll Now

    OpenCourser is an affiliate partner of Treehouse and may earn a commission when you buy through our links.

    Get a Reminder

    Send to:
    Rating Not enough ratings
    Length 146-minute iOS Course
    Starts On Demand (Start anytime)
    Cost $25/month (Access to entire library- free trial available)
    From Treehouse
    Instructor Pasan Premaratne
    Download Videos Only via web browser
    Language English
    Subjects Programming
    Tags iOS

    Get a Reminder

    Send to:

    Similar Courses

    Careers

    An overview of related careers and their average salaries in the US. Bars indicate income percentile.

    Jet magazine entertainment writer, copy editor, co-managing editor, features editor $47k

    Assistant Staff Arts & Entertainment/Features writer $52k

    Acting Features Editor $58k

    Editor of Features Production $58k

    Special Features Journalist $59k

    Columnist/Features Writer $63k

    Assistant Features Apprentice $63k

    Features Department Coordinator $64k

    Features Writer & Online Producer $73k

    Senior Features Apprentice $74k

    Senior consulting features editor $89k

    Deputy features news editor $95k

    Write a review

    Your opinion matters. Tell us what you think.

    Rating Not enough ratings
    Length 146-minute iOS Course
    Starts On Demand (Start anytime)
    Cost $25/month (Access to entire library- free trial available)
    From Treehouse
    Instructor Pasan Premaratne
    Download Videos Only via web browser
    Language English
    Subjects Programming
    Tags iOS

    Similar Courses

    Sorted by relevance

    Like this course?

    Here's what to do next:

    • Save this course for later
    • Get more details from the course provider
    • Enroll in this course
    Enroll Now